How to perform data backup and restore in MySQL?
MySQL is a commonly used relational database management system used to manage and store large amounts of data. When using MySQL, data backup and restore are very important to ensure data security and integrity. This article explains how to perform data backup and restore in MySQL and provides code examples.
Data backup refers to copying the data in the database to another location to prevent data loss or damage. Data restoration refers to restoring backed up data to the database to re-establish the original database state.
1. Data backup:
-
Use the mysqldump command to back up the entire database:
1
mysqldump -u 用户名 -p 密码 数据库名 > 备份文件路径
Copy after loginSample code:
1
$ mysqldump -u root -p123456 mydatabase > /home/backup/mydatabase.sql
Copy after loginThe above command will Back up the database named "mydatabase" and save the backup file in the /home/backup/ directory with the file name mydatabase.sql. Before executing this command, you need to provide your MySQL username and password.
Use the mysqldump command to back up the specified table:
1
mysqldump -u 用户名 -p 密码 数据库名 表名 > 备份文件路径
Copy after loginSample code:
1
$ mysqldump -u root -p123456 mydatabase mytable > /home/backup/mytable.sql
Copy after loginThe above command will back up the table named "mytable" where the table is located The database is "mydatabase" and the backup file is saved in the /home/backup/ directory with the file name mytable.sql.
Use the mysqldump command to back up data under specified conditions:
1
mysqldump -u 用户名 -p 密码 数据库名 表名 --where=
"备份条件"
> 备份文件路径
Copy after loginSample code:
1
$ mysqldump -u root -p123456 mydatabase mytable --where=
"id > 100"
> /home/backup/mytable.sql
Copy after loginThe above command will back up the table named "mytable", The database where the table is located is "mydatabase". The backup condition is that the ID is greater than 100. Save the backup file in the /home/backup/ directory and the file name is mytable.sql.
2. Data restoration:
Use the mysql command to restore the entire database:
1
mysql -u 用户名 -p 密码 数据库名 < 备份文件路径
Copy after loginCopy after loginSample code:
1
$ mysql -u root -p123456 mydatabase < /home/backup/mydatabase.sql
Copy after loginThe above command will restore the database named "mydatabase". The database file is mydatabase.sql in the /home/backup/ directory. Before executing this command, you need to provide your MySQL username and password.
Use the mysql command to restore the specified table:
1
mysql -u 用户名 -p 密码 数据库名 < 备份文件路径
Copy after loginCopy after loginSample code:
1
$ mysql -u root -p123456 mydatabase < /home/backup/mytable.sql
Copy after loginThe above command will restore the table named "mytable" where the table is located The database is "mydatabase", and the database file is mytable.sql in the /home/backup/ directory.
